James F. Finke,
age 93, 935 E. Jefferson, Morton, formerly of Quincy died Wednesday, March 7 at 12:35 am
in his home.
He was born July 30, 1913 in Quincy, Illinois, the son of Fred M. Finke
and Lena Vorndam Finke.
On October 9, 1937, he married Evelyn H. Mayfield in Quincy. She
preceeded him in death on November 29, 2005.
Mr. Finke lived in Quincy for many years and from August 15, 1929 to
August 1975 he was employed as a teller at Mercantile Trust and Savings Bank. After
retirement the Finkes moved to Florida where they lived until they moved to Morton to be
near their daughter. Mr. Finke was a member of Bethel Lutheran Church in Morton and had
been a member of St. James Lutheran Church while in Quincy.
Survivors include: a daughter, Sara K. Cornwell and her husband Larry
of Morton; 4 grandchildren, Brent D. Cornwell and his wife Dimitia of Lombard, IL; Krista
L. Suri and her husband Bhuvan of Baltimore, MD; Michelle Walker and her husband Jeff of
Banner Elk, N.C.; Todd M. Cornwell of Boulder, CO, and 9 great grandchildren. In addition
to his wife, he was preceded in death by his sister Vera A. Haller.
